随着业务发展,您用于对外提供服务的单个ECS实例可能已经扩展至多个。为了让对外提供服务的IP保持不变,您可以将原来ECS实例所分配的固定公网IP转为弹性公网IP(EIP),然后将该EIP绑定到负载均衡SLB或其他ECS实例上,在不影响业务的情况下完成水平扩容。本文介绍如何将固定公网IP转为EIP。
固定公网IP和EIP的区别
转换须知
须知项 | 说明 |
转换情况 | 固定公网IP转换为EIP后,无法将其转换回原来的固定公网IP。 但您可以先解绑EIP,再调整ECS公网带宽大小的方式,分配一个新的固定公网IP地址。具体操作,请参见包年包月实例修改带宽或按量付费实例修改带宽。 说明 您也可以通过调用ModifyInstanceNetworkSpec修改ECS实例的带宽大小,为其分配一个新的固定公网IP地址。 |
IP地址 | 保持不变,原有的公网IP地址直接转换为弹性公网IP地址。 |
公网带宽计费方式 | 转换后,公网带宽计费方式保持不变。 |
关于费用 | 转换后的EIP将单独计费,单独产生账单。关于EIP计费,请参见EIP计费概述。 重要 如果固定公网IP转换为EIP后,再将EIP的计费方式由按量付费转换为包年包月,可能会存在一定差价,请您谨慎操作。更多信息,请参见公网IP转换EIP后为什么存在差价? |
前提条件
固定IP转换为EIP前,请确保ECS实例已满足以下要求:
实例的网络类型为专有网络VPC,且已为实例分配了公网IP地址。
实例计费方式为按量付费时,您的账号不能处于欠费状态。
实例计费方式为包年包月时,到期前24小时内不支持此操作,且公网带宽计费方式必须是按使用流量计费。按固定带宽计费的公网带宽可以转为按使用流量计费,具体操作,请参见按固定带宽转按使用流量。
已操作过实例规格变更时,请等待变更生效后再转换公网IP地址。
ECS实例处于运行中或者已停止状态。
操作步骤
您也可以调用API ConvertNatPublicIpToEip完成操作。使用API时,请确保您使用的是4.3.0及以上版本的SDK,请下载最新版的SDK。更多信息,请参见安装和使用ECS SDK。
登录ECS管理控制台。
在左侧导航栏,选择 。
在页面左侧顶部,选择目标资源所在的资源组和地域。
找到网络类型为专有网络且需要转换IP地址的ECS实例,在操作列中,选择
。在弹出的对话框中,确认信息后,单击确定。
刷新实例列表,查看执行结果。
专有网络VPC公网IP转换为EIP后,原公网IP地址会被标注为弹性。
您可以单击这个IP地址前往弹性公网IP管理控制台查看并操作弹性公网IP。
相关操作
专有网络VPC公网IP转换为EIP后,您可以执行以下操作:
将转换后的EIP与ECS实例解绑,并绑定到负载均衡SLB或其他ECS实例上。具体操作,请参见绑定和解绑弹性公网IP。
使用共享流量包和共享带宽来节省您的公网成本。具体操作,请参见如何节约公网成本。
释放EIP使其停止计费:EIP未释放之前均会收费,如不再使用请自行释放。具体操作,请参见释放按量计费EIP实例。